The time had finally come to get some water into the stream and leat. The intention was to use one of the poured water systems and after some research I settled on Magic Water which I acquired from EDM models.


I of course read the instructions fully before using it (didn't I? - oh!) so took all the necessary precautions to avoid any issues - but:
  • It leaked. It shouldn't have - I had tested it with water several times, each time plugging all the leaks with waterproof PVA, varnish etc. It didn't leak that much but luckily most of the drips fell on the newspaper which was still down from the prior leak checks. I think one of the problems is it takes hours to set so has plenty of time to ooze through any tiny holes.
  • There were very prominent meniscusses (menisci?) especially along the leat and around the viaduct piers. This was partly a result of wicking into porous scenery and vegetation (as noted in the instructions), and also possibly through loss of resin, i.e. the meniscus was the high tide and the level went down slightly through the leaks.
 The instructions suggest the water feature should be made before you do the rest of the scenery, and any porous scenery should be prepared with a thin paint of Magic Water along the waterline. This is all very well but it meant I should have done it 12 years ago. And in this time the plans have changed - the large waterwheel and launder having been (perhaps temporarily) abandoned when it became clear they were never going to be built in time for the big outing.

I tried to cover up the meniscus with vegetation but it was simply too prominent, and vegetation would not look right around the bridge piers etc. The resin sets to a rubbery state so it could not be easily scraped away - and it would probably have made it look worse. I eventually decided it needed a thin top coat. I reasoned that it had done any leaking and wicking that it was going to do, so this thin top coat should hopefully just fill the surface up to the top of the menisci. Of course I had now used up all the Magic Water.


A bit of late night internet searching showed there were several suitable clear resins - all quick setting which should enable corrective action to be taken during whilst it sets. I contacted Eli-Chem Resins UK who sold two types at a reasonable price. As a result of their helpful advice I ordered a General Purpose Clear Epoxy 350g starter kit - despite choosing their standard 5 day delivery it arrived the very next day!

I dribbled a thin coat into the middle of the leat and worked it into place with a spatula to just fill the meniscus. When it started to thicken up I carefully swept any build up away from the edges with a small coffee stirrer.

The result is much better. The top coat has set very clear with a hard glass like finish and the menisci are far less prominent. What remains can easily be hidden with some judicous planting.

Hedges (walls if you are from up Country)

Experiments continue on hedging. The basis is corrugated cardboard stuck down with a hot glue gun and then coated with a gloop made from slightly diluted PVA and lots of loo paper coloured with a big dollop of raw sienna goache (yes it looks like what one could find down a sewer but obviously without the smell). This is trowelled on with an icing knife. It stays soft and sticky for days giving plenty of time for adjustments but will eventually dry hard and strong and is very light.

The following photos were the result of a couple of hours spent adding rocks to simulate a typical moorland type granite hedge. The stones are coloured filler/PVA mix spread out to dry on foil then broken up by hand and pressed into the gloop. Static grass was added with a puffer and some scatter and foam added by hand.

I'm pleased with the stonework and from a distance the vegetation looks reasonable but the close-ups show the grass is not ideal. When it eventually dries I may clean it off a bit with a toothbrush and then apply rough grass (carpet underlay and/or plumbers hemp), bushes (a la Gravett) and static grass (properly).

Bridges and Sheds

Progress has been slow but I have installed parapets on the remaining two bridges and some walking boards so the PLR track gang should hopefully be a bit safer (although this was the 1950s).

This shot also shots the quarry engine shed. This has been made with scale corrugated iron sheets from (IIRC) Metalsmith with 1/16" square brass for the main frame and wooden strips for the rest. The corrugated iron fairly quickly started rusting after soldering, but as there were still shiny bits I painted it with gun blue and then washed it off. The next day the whole outside was totally rusted. Whilst the rust looks good I'm not sure if all of every sheet would be like that in the prototype, so I am deliberating if I should try and paint on some grey in places to represent non-rusty areas.

I have some more corrugated iron buildings to make so may try and paint bits of the sheets first, or at least before wielding the gun blue.

Telegraph Poles

Over the last month or two I have been attempting to install telephone poles on the PLR. The idea is that there is a circuit going down the line with a telephone on a pole at the quarry loop (to discuss their traffic requirements). In practice this means a two wire circuit down the line to the viaduct at which point the main circuit crosses to the lower line and through the tunnel, and the original wires continuing to an end pole on the quarry loop.

In my hunt for prototype inspiration I came across the following wonderful sites: Teleramics, Double Groove and Telegraph Pole Appreciation Society (I defy anyone to call railway modellers sad after seeing this: here)

I was particular taken with the swan neck type of insulator fitting from Double Groove below as I thought it would be appropriate (cheap) for the forever strapped for cash PLR.
Image linked from Double Groove

After queries on the O14 group etc. for suitable sources drew a blank I started out making my own as outlined below (I was beyond the point of no return when I found out Wenz Modellbau did some kits) .

I ended up getting a casting starter kit from Nigel Lawton 009 and making a master with 4 insulators on it from which I made a silicon mould. Trying to cast with resin (with various colouring agents) proved almost impossible due to air bubbles and the very fast cure time. Coloured (artists pigment) 12minute epoxy was better, but the best results were with white/superfine Milliput. Piano wire was used for the swan necks poked into the Milliput.

Poles were made from dowels, slightly tapered with sandpaper, aged with my cider vinegar/steel wool solution (see previous post), felt tip for knots, and washes with ink and watercolours. The bases have a square rod which fits into a square tube in the basement so they all line up correctly (every pole has it's place), and all were given a yellow/green algae spray on the North East face. Caps were made from cartridge paper painted with grey acrylic mix. The guy ropes were made from fine electric wire innards blasted with a blowtorch to blacken it.

Ageing Wood with Cider Vinegar

I'm slowly making a set of telegraph poles for the PLR and particularly want to try and reproduce that rather elusive aged and weathered look. As start I thought I would try and age the wood itself with a suitable potion. A bit of googling turned up a recipe for a home made potion made from vinegar and iron filings. I ended up using organic cider vinegar (nothing but the best for PLR - actually it turns out to be stronger than red wine vinegar which was the only other thing in the kitchen cupboard) and steel wool left to stew for a couple of days. I tried using several dilutions of this on a piece of dowel as shown below:

From left to right dilutions of: 1:4, 1:3, 1:2 and 1:1. I felt the 1:2 looked best so then tried this on a full sized pole and also several other pieces of wood as shown below:

From left to right: treated and untreated dowel poles, thin and thick coffee stirrers and finally Scale 7 group walnut sleepers.

In many respects the dowel poles was the least successful as they still have a decidedly yellow tinge but I think further painting and weathering will tone this down. The coffee stirrers have a really pleasing grey hue which I am sure I will take advantage of sometime - it actually makes me wish I had done all my sleepers like this rather than my usual potion of Jacobean dark oak stain. The most surprising effect was on the walnut sleepers which have become almost as black as ebony.

They all smell slightly of vinegar and must be still acidic, so I'm wondering whether I should try and neutralise this using Bicarbonate of Soda (another kitchen find) or whether this may ruin the effect. Perhaps another test is due.

Ballasting

This winter has seen me finally get around to ballasting. I started on the big scenic section which is destined to be exhibited in 2014 but was so pleased with the results that I vowed to get rid of as much of the yellow peril foam underlay as possible. I realise having this colour everywhere for so long was really getting to me and colouring (sorry) my judgement. With hindsight I wished I had painted the foam grey or suchlike before any sleepers were laid.

I needed to ensure the ballasting did not affect the ability of the track to float on the underlay which rules out PVA which would have locked it up solid. Luckily Copydex which is flexible, can be diluted and used in much the same manner. Tests done some years ago proved it works, however some ballast has come away in places possibly because it was applied too thinly. This time I set out to find the optimum methods and glue mix.


A lot of the PLR was ballasted with china clay waste as it was cheap and readily available. Earlier this year someone mentioned both chinchilla dust and sieved cat litter as suitable and cheap ballasting materials. Having acquired a bag of each, I then had to dash both my daughters' hopes as to the true purposes of my purchases - they are still demanding the appropriate animals be acquired.





I thought about making a ballast spreader of the type both commercially sold and similar DIY versions, but in the end a teaspoon, fingers and a cheap small paintbrush ended up being the best method of spreading. I laid ballast on about 9 yds of track length with pointwork in a couple of hours. In places I followed a useful tip from a forum somewhere, which was to paint neat glue alongside the track which holds the sprinkled ballast in place.

I had read that diluted IPA (Isopropyl alcohol, not the type of beer) was a good wetting agent and dilutant. It might be for PVA but not Copydex - adding some to a Copydex/water mix almost instantly formed a large ball of solid rubber. Dripping diluted Copydex into an IPA wetted ballast produced similar surface lumps.  I also tried screen wash as a dilutant with no perceivable benefits, so resorted to good old washing up liquid. I made up a decent quantity of water with a generous slug of washing up liquid in it (you could see the colour) and then used that in my spray bottle and to dilute the Copydex, mixing the latter only when about to be used. I didn't measure the ratio used but is probably more than 10 parts water to 1 part Copydex, i.e. very thin, like skimmed milk.


My first spray bottle sputtered out blobs too which rather upset my carefully laid ballast - especially the chinchilla dust. My daughter suggested trying a chemist and I found a small pump action spray for £1.59 which produces a gentle mist. The final technique was to mist something like 12" ahead and follow in a zig-zag fashion with diluted Copydex using a dropper between each set of sleepers between, and either side of the rails, and trying to avoid the sleeper tops and rails themselves, using enough so the ballast fills up with the water/glue mix (as if swamped with milk). To ensure it is properly stuck down (and as the mix is so thin) I repeated the glue dropping the next day before it had dried out. In fact it took several days to completely dry out and as I discovered it also forms a very effective short circuit until dried.

Both the cat litter and chinchilla dust darken when wet. The cat litter also seems to expand a little so some tamping down was done whilst still wet. When dried it reverts to the original natural colours, so much so it looks like it is still loose, but a quick prod will show it is not. To finish off I cleaned the railhead with a block of MDF and then my leather strip rail cleaner (I never use anything abrasive) and some scraping of sleepers and cleaning out the point flangeways etc., interspersed with hoovering. As it is very flexible it is also possible to squash down any raised ballast lumps.
